Dangote Refinery set to become world’s biggest, plans 1.4 million bpd processing capacity
The move will take the crude oil processing facility, currently Africa’s Largest refinery and the world’s biggest single-train refinery, the largest in the world, past India’s Jamnagar Refinery.
Child Trafficking: NAPTIP rescues 26 children, arrests orphanage owner, fingers NACRAN founder
Operatives of the National Agency for the Prohibition of Trafficking in Persons rescued no fewer than 26 trafficked children at an orphanage home in Benue.

Protests Erupt In Cameroon As Opposition Supporters Demand Recognition Of ‘Election Victory’
Protests erupted across Cameroon on Sunday as opposition supporters demanded that authorities recognise Issa Tchiroma Bakary’s purported election victory.

Four dead in Cameroon opposition protests ahead of election results
Four people were killed in clashes between security forces and supporters of a Cameroon opposition leader who claims to have won recent presidential elections, authorities said ahead of the announcement of official results Monday.
